I Might Be Wrong
I think the band’s name may stem from that Radiohead Live album, but I could be wrong. However, from what I’ve heard, the album should be sugary gold. RIYL – Frou Frou, CareBears, and Licorice…. You can check more them out here or perhaps by the album…
I Might Be Wrong-Cold Comfort [mp3]